tas2580
Blog über Webentwicklung

HTML - <textarea>

Definiert ein mehrzeiliges Eingabefeld (Textbereich)

Beispiel

<textarea rows="4" cols="50">
Hier kann Text stehen
</textarea>

Demo


Definition und Verwendung

Der <textarea> -Tag definiert ein mehrzeiliges Texteingabefeld.

Ein Textbereich kann eine unbegrenzte Anzahl von Zeichen beinhalten.

Die Größe eines Textbereichs kann durch die cols und rows Attribute angegeben werden, oder noch besser, durch die CSS Eigenschaften height und width.


Browser Unterstützung

Chrome 1.0
Firefox 1.0
Safari 1.0
Opera 3.5
Edge 12.0
IE 4.0

Attribute

Attribute stellen zusätzliche Informationen über HTML-Elemente bereit. Attribute müssen immer in den öffnenden Tag geschrieben werden.

Attribut Wert Beschreibung
autofocus Gibt an, dass ein Textbereich automatisch Fokus bekommen soll, wenn die Seite geladen wird.
cols Zahl Gibt die sichtbare Breite den Textbereich an.
dirname textareaname.dir Gibt die Textrichtung des Textbereich an.
disabled Gibt an, dass der Textbereich deaktiviert werden soll.
form form_id Gibt eine oder mehrere Formulare an zu denen der Textbereich gehört.
maxlength Zahl Gibt die maximale Anzahl der Zeichen die im Textbereich erlaubt sind an.
name Text Gibt einen Namen für den Textbereich an.
placeholder Text Gibt einen kurzen Hinweis, der den erwarteten Wert eines Textbereich beschreibt an.
readonly Gibt an, dass der Textbereich schreibgeschützt werden soll.
required Gibt an, dass ein Textbereich erforderlich ist / ausgefüllt werden muss.
rows Zahl Gibt die sichtbare Anzahl der Zeilen in einem Textbereich an.
wrap hard soft Gibt an, wie der Text in einem Textbereich umgebrochen werden soll.

Der <textarea> Tag verwendet Globale HTML Attribute.